1949 World Series: Yankees Dominate

In the 1949 World Series, the New York Yankees faced off against the Brooklyn Dodgers. The Yankees, led by Joe DiMaggio, proved to be too strong, winning the series 4-1. The Yankees' offensive firepower and strong pitching staff were too much for the Dodgers to handle. 1953 World Series: Yankees Triumph Again

Fast forward to the 1953 World Series, where the Yankees and Dodgers met again. This time, the Yankees, powered by the likes of Mickey Mantle and Yogi Berra, once again prevailed, winning in six games. 1955 World Series: Dodgers Finally Break Through

Ah, the 1955 World Series! This series holds a special place in baseball history because it marked the Brooklyn Dodgers' first and only World Series title against the Yankees. The Dodgers, led by Jackie Robinson and a host of other legendary players, finally broke through, winning the series in seven games. The series was a thrilling back-and-forth affair, with both teams showcasing their determination. 1963 World Series: Dodgers Dominate Again

Fast forward to the 1963 World Series, and the Dodgers, now in Los Angeles, once again faced the Yankees. The Dodgers, led by Sandy Koufax and their incredible pitching staff, swept the Yankees in four games. Koufax's dominant performance was a major highlight, showcasing his legendary talent.
